WebDiverticulitis. When the pouches in your colon get infected. About half of all Americans over age 60 will have diverticulosis. Some people with diverticulosis also get diverticulitis. Diverticular disease is often seen in developed countries. It is very common in the United States, England, and Australia. People in these countries eat less fiber. AGA suggests against elective colonic resection in patients with an initial episode of acute uncomplicated diverticulitis. The decision to perform elective prophylactic colonic resection in this setting should be individualized. 4. AGA suggests a fiber-rich diet or fiber supplementation in patients with a history of acute diverticulitis. ecc memory rank https://mariancare.org

WebProvide Bowel Rest. Maintain NPO status during initial phase of antibiotic treatment to kill infection and help bowel rest As symptoms decrease, advance diet to clear liquids and then increase fiber slowly. Assess abdominal pain. Detailed abdominal assessments will indicate if inflammation or infection may be developing. WebA diverticulum is a small pouch that forms in the wall of the colon. Diverticulitis occurs when that pouch becomes infected and/or inflamed. Symptoms include pain, fever, and chills. Left untreated, it can worsen and lead to an abscess or bowel obstruction. It can also create a hole in your colon that connects to other structures, such as your ...

WebMar 14, 2024 · Diverticulosis — Diverticulosis merely describes the presence of diverticula. Diverticulosis is often found during a test done for other reasons, such as flexible sigmoidoscopy, colonoscopy, or barium enema.
